Programmeur(se) logiciel en chef(fe) | Lead Software Programmer - Ghostpunch
Job description
Employer Industry: Gaming Development
Why consider this job opportunity:
- Opportunity for career advancement and growth within the organization
- Collaborative and dynamic work environment
- Engage in hands-on programming and technical leadership
- Contribute to innovative game design and development processes
- Work with a talented team of professionals in the gaming industry
What to Expect (Job Responsibilities):
- Establish strong working relationships with the Director of Technology, team programmers, and the assigned Producer
- Provide leadership and technical guidance to fellow Software Engineers on the development team
- Participate in the game programming design process and maintain communication with other disciplines
- Write and debug core engine and game code, as well as develop advanced tools to support projects
- Create the Technical Design Document (TDD) and manage project scope and resource allocation
What is Required (Qualifications):
- Must possess superior oral and written communication skills and interpersonal skills
- Minimum educational requirement: Bachelor's degree in Computer Science or related field
- At least 4 years of experience as a Programmer/Software Engineer in the gaming industry
- Working knowledge of C/C++ and assembly language
- Experience in Programming/Software Design on at least 1 shipping game product from beginning to end
How to Stand Out (Preferred Qualifications):
- Prior management or leadership training and/or experience
- Deep understanding of gaming industry hardware and software trends
- Hands-on knowledge of basic game design and implementation
- Ability to optimize development workflows across various disciplines
- Strong desire to write game code